Page 1 of 2

Не реагирует на нап

Posted: 17 Jun 2016, 21:22
by Hydras
Сегодня впервые столкнулся с проблемой напов на деревню. Нажимаю сканировать атаки, он заходит в пункт сбора, открывает вкладку приходящих войск и сортирует по атакующим. Но дальше никак не реагирует. Список обнаруженных напов пустой. Идёт человек за 34 часа. Может ли это быть изза такого большого количества времени до напа?

Re: Не реагирует на нап

Posted: 17 Jun 2016, 21:35
by Hydras
Сейчас протестили, отправили 1 юнита на меня с ходом около 3 часов - бот увидел нап. А вот сейчас пока пишу этот пост вышли на мой оазис, идти 18 минут человеку и вручную бот не видит этот нап. И даже в аську не стучится по поводу напа на оаз

Re: Не реагирует на нап

Posted: 23 Jun 2016, 10:16
by Vlad
Он за эти 18 минут не искал атаки, или искал но не увидел?
Каши чистили в меню?

Re: Не реагирует на нап

Posted: 18 Sep 2016, 16:55
by vsd
А у меня звук не проигрывает и письмо не шлет. Напы он видит, сканит атакующего, кто-что, и все. Кэши чистил.
Вот лог:
18.09.2016 19:08:14: Начат поиск атак
18.09.2016 19:08:41: Произошло исключение!
18.09.2016 19:08:41: Type: EConvertError App version: 4.1.2.6
18.09.2016 19:08:41: Message: '' is not a valid integer value
18.09.2016 19:08:41: ------------------------------------------------------------------------ Call Stack ------------------------------------------------------------------------
18.09.2016 19:08:41: > [0040A502] SysUtils.ConvertErrorFmt (Line 3035, "SysUtils.pas")
18.09.2016 19:08:41: > [0040B4E1] SysUtils.StrToInt (Line 4072, "SysUtils.pas")
18.09.2016 19:08:41: > [007554B0] Main.TForm1.NapSearch (Line 20606, "Source\Main.pas")
18.09.2016 19:08:41: > [00404B22] System.@HandleFinally
18.09.2016 19:08:41: > [00720DF0] Main.TForm1.NapSearchTimerTimer (Line 12081, "Source\Main.pas")
18.09.2016 19:08:41: > [0077DFA8] Main.TForm1.DoNapSearch (Line 27777, "Source\Main.pas")
18.09.2016 19:08:41: > [00471CBF] Controls.TControl.WndProc (Line 4561, "Controls.pas")
18.09.2016 19:08:41: > [00475ACC] Controls.TWinControl.DefaultHandler (Line 6269, "Controls.pas")
18.09.2016 19:08:41: > [00404564] System.@CallDynaInst
18.09.2016 19:08:41: > [0047235B] Controls.TControl.WMMouseMove (Line 4735, "Controls.pas")
18.09.2016 19:08:41: > [00471CBF] Controls.TControl.WndProc (Line 4561, "Controls.pas")
18.09.2016 19:08:41: ------------------------------------------------------------------------------------------------------------------------------------------------------------

Re: Не реагирует на нап

Posted: 20 Sep 2016, 14:35
by vsd
Сегодня сработало. Ничего не менял.

Re: Не реагирует на нап

Posted: 19 Oct 2016, 18:34
by vsd
Заметил такой момент: бот не реагирует на напы дальше чем 24 часа, как только до напа остается меньше чем 24 часа он находит напы. При этом не правильно определяет время отправки и возможные юниты в напе, так как считает что нап был отправлен 24 часа плюс/минус интервал поиска атак.

Re: Не реагирует на нап

Posted: 20 Oct 2016, 10:15
by Vlad
проверю
В игре формат времени 24 часа стоит же?

Re: Не реагирует на нап

Posted: 20 Oct 2016, 11:12
by Vlad
Проверьте в 4.1.3.0

Re: Не реагирует на нап

Posted: 20 Oct 2016, 17:10
by vsd
Vlad wrote:Проверьте в 4.1.3.0
Как будут нападать, посмотрю. По результатам отпишусь.

Re: Не реагирует на нап

Posted: 07 Feb 2017, 19:02
by vsd
Все работало, пока не выслали очень длинный спам... более 100 часов ходу.
Периодически бот сигнализирует о напе, причем на почту высылает только время обнаружения:
"07.02.2017 18:30:44: Login: Vovansir

07.02.2017 18:30:44: We are under attack"

И так может быть 2-3 раза в день.
Атак не прибавлялось.
При прибавлении атак, новые атаки видит как положено: время прибытия, кто атакует, откуда, и т.д.